Output cafc4595162e7e4623626df6b66dac40274dd12cdfec9a90408d3e389bf6beda:1

value
42990383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ea4d5f3b60dbfdf779d0eaa3860bb3151095fc OP_EQUAL
address
35RMdpcAiE6PeXZjWFtFm8E1MJUizuwQNy
transaction
cafc4595162e7e4623626df6b66dac40274dd12cdfec9a90408d3e389bf6beda
spent
true